Roles and Responsibilities
The Women’s World Banking Financial Inclusion Forum is a convening that brings together key stakeholders across the ecosystem including thought leaders, financial service providers, investors, policymakers, committed to advancing women’s financial inclusion. The Forum will be held in South Africa and will feature high-level plenaries, interactive sessions, networking opportunities, and innovative showcases of solutions that drive financial equality for women.
Women’s World Banking seeks an event producer or event production company to provide comprehensive event management services, ensuring the successful execution of this high-profile event.
Objectives & Responsibilities
- Event Planning & Logistics: Venue proposal and management, supplier coordination, contract negotiation, and on-site execution.
- Production Management: Overseeing all technical aspects, including AV, stage design, and live-streaming components.
- Program Execution Support: Coordinating speaker logistics, session management, and event run-of-show.
- Audience Experience & Engagement: Implementing best practices to create an engaging attendee experience, including registration and branding.
- On-Site Management: Leading event-day operations, troubleshooting, and ensuring a seamless experience for all participants.
- Post-Event Reporting: Providing a debrief report summarizing key metrics, successes, and areas for improvement.

About Women's World Banking
We believe in being a force for the greater good, devoted to accelerating and growing the financial inclusion of women. With rapidly changing markets, influenced by technology and social behavioral expectations, we are embarking on a new chapter to transform the way we design and implement solutions.
For over 40 years, Women’s World Banking has partnered with financial institutions, showing them the benefit of investing in women as customers. We equip these institutions with in-depth research and data driven insights to develop financial products and educational programs. While our clients are financial service providers, our mission is to engage consumers – women who are marginalized by financial systems.
